#65f936 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65f936 is composed of 39.6% red, 97.6%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.3%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 105.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 59.4%. #65f936 color hex could be obtained by blending #caff6c with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#65f936 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#65f936 has RGB values of R:101, G:249,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6682934.
| Hex triplet | 65f936 | #65f936 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 101, 249, 54 | rgb(101,249,54) |
| RGB Percent | 39.6, 97.6, 21.2 | rgb(39.6%,97.6%,21.2%) |
| CMYK | 59, 0, 78, 2 | |
| HSL | 105.5°, 94.2, 59.4 | hsl(105.5,94.2%,59.4%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 105.5°, 78.3, 97.6 | |
| Web Safe | 66ff33 | #66ff33 |
| CIE-LAB | 87.379, -71.195, 74.833 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 39.907, 70.781, 15.049 |
| xyY | 0.317, 0.563, 70.781 |
| CIE-LCH | 87.379, 103.289, 133.573 |
| CIE-LUV | 87.379, -66.614, 99.01 |
| Hunter-Lab | 84.132, -62.561, 48.287 |
| Binary | 01100101, 11111001, 00110110 |
